We are influenced by the amazing ingredients and rich food culture found all around the Mediterranean, and especially in this corner of Spain. We are full-board and serve breakfast, lunch, afternoon tea, early evening tapas and dinner.

We serve a set menu, but we’re always flexible to accommodate your tastes and dietary requirements. We love the local seasonal produce that lends itself to vegetarian or vegan diets, and we have experience in catering for coeliacs.

In Spain, children are welcome at the dinner table with the grown-ups, but we appreciate that for British children, used to an earlier timetable, this can be difficult (for the parents!) so we are happy to serve a high tea to children needing an earlier bedtime.

Breakfast

Breakfast is served buffet-style. There is always fresh fruit, yogurt and cereals. We bake our own sourdough bread and might have banana waffles or cinnamon buns, along with eggs cooked to order.

Lunch

Every day we provide a freshly prepared picnic to take with you on your adventures. Choose from a bagel, wrap, focaccia or sourdough sub with a wide range of fillings, plus homemade cake or snack bar, fresh fruit, crisps or nuts and a juice box.

Dinner

In the evenings, relax on the veranda with a cold San Miguel and a tapa of salt cod bunyols (fritters) or chilled melon soup with serrano ham, before sitting down together for dinner. Dinner could be the Catalan ‘Arros Negre’ (black rice) made with the freshest fish, preserved lemons and squid ink. Or a slow roasted-shoulder of local lamb. Kids especially love pizza night where they can roll out and top their own pizza and see it cooked in the wood oven. Dessert range from the traditional Crema Catalana, to the classic Spanish treat, loved by children of all ages, Churros con Chocolate; and there is always homemade ice cream in a variety of flavours.
